The canal parade is one of the biggest and free open air events from the Netherlands, Its one big floating carnival with colourful people dancing on boats, floats and the key sides. Its big like Kings Day only now it will be all the colours of the rainbow instead orange. Because Amsterdam is also hosting EuroPride in 2016 it will be a very special one this year.
The canal parade is a party for everybody; no matter who you are who you love or where you are from 80 LGBTI-organisations show of in a festive manner for what they stand and fight for every first Saturday of August.
You can follow the parade from the key side but even better from your own (Rented maybe?) boat.
The route
The floats will start their route in the Westerdok and will sail eastwards via the Prinsengracht, Amstel, After the famous (Magere brug ) to starboard into Nieuwe Herengracht towards the Oosterdok and Scheepvaart museum where the famous 3 masted tallship Clipper Stad Amsterdam will salute all the floats.(After the parade is a chance to sail past the Clipper Stad Amsterdam and see it up close) The first float leaves at the Prinsengracht at 14.00h and the the last float will close the parade at the end around 18.00h. Make sure you arrive on time to reserve a spot from your self or in a boat

The day after: Just like any of those good parties at home: make a mess, but on the day after, you might feel like helping out with the cleaning.
THis year, you can join Plastic whale with cleaning the canals the day after more info here (sorry no english) Hopefully soon. A pretty cool organisation that takes plastic out of the canals and turns it in to skateboards and boats.
